ok im trying to figure out how to remove or unscrew the old linkake . i have the pedals and shift rod off of the bike. just cant seem to unscrew it to put the new one on any help thanks
 
#2 ·
After removing screws that hold hiem joints....unscrew heim joints. One end will have right hand threads and other left hand threads...or reverse threads.cheers
 
#5 ·
Douse the nut liberally with PB Blaster or any other penetrating oil, not WD40. Let it sit an hour or so. Tighten the nut then loosen it. It should come off with a little persuasion. If you're still having an issue, extend your wrench by putting a 12 or 18 inch long piece of pipe over the wrench. Tighten first then loosen.
